如何在MySQL中判断日期是否相等

更新时间:02-09 教程 由 暗香浮 分享

MySQL是一种流行的关系型数据库管理系统,它可以用来存储和管理大量的数据。当我们需要在MySQL中比较日期时,我们需要使用特定的函数来判断日期是否相等。在本文中,我们将介绍。

第一步:了解MySQL中的日期类型

在MySQL中,有几种不同的日期类型,包括DATE、DATETIME、TIMESTAMP等。这些类型的区别在于它们所能存储的日期范围不同,以及它们的存储方式不同。

- DATE类型:用于存储日期值,格式为'YYYY-MM-DD',其中YYYY表示年份,MM表示月份,DD表示日期。

- DATETIME类型:用于存储日期和时间值,格式为'YYYY-MM-DD HH:MM:SS',其中HH表示小时,MM表示分钟,SS表示秒。

- TIMESTAMP类型:也用于存储日期和时间值,但它所能存储的日期范围比DATETIME类型更小。

第二步:使用DATE函数判断日期是否相等

在MySQL中,我们可以使用DATE函数来比较两个日期是否相等。DATE函数可以将日期格式化为'YYYY-MM-DD'的形式,从而进行比较。例如,我们可以使用以下语句来比较两个日期是否相等:

amen) = '2022-01-01';

amen表示包含日期的列名。这个语句将返回所有日期等于'2022-01-01'的行。

第三步:使用DATE_FORMAT函数判断日期是否相等

除了使用DATE函数之外,我们还可以使用DATE_FORMAT函数来比较两个日期是否相等。DATE_FORMAT函数可以将日期按照指定的格式进行格式化。例如,我们可以使用以下语句来比较两个日期是否相等:

amen-%d') = '2022-01-01';

表示两位月份,%d表示两位日期。这个语句将返回所有日期等于'2022-01-01'的行。

在MySQL中,我们可以使用DATE函数或DATE_FORMAT函数来比较两个日期是否相等。使用这些函数可以帮助我们更轻松地处理日期数据,并且提高我们的工作效率。如果您在使用MySQL时需要比较日期,请牢记这些函数的使用方法。

声明:关于《如何在MySQL中判断日期是否相等》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2154990.html